I just discovered that 3 of my 7 girls have bumblefoot! Ugh! This is my first time dealing with it. I knew it was only a matter of time. They all have the telltale black scab on the bottom of one foot and slight swelling between the toes. Not anything like marble sized swelling, just one foot is slightly larger than the other between the toes. The swelling is squishy to the touch (not hard at all) and feels a little warm. It's almost like it's just filled with a little bit of liquid. They are NOT limping at all and do not seem to be bothered by it.
From what I've read on here, I think I've caught it fairly early enough that I'm going to try to Tricide-Neo for a week and see how that goes. I read that someone suggested not to do the surgery if the chickens aren't limping yet, which makes sense to me. No limping with my 3 girls, so hopefully the Tricide-Neo works!
